Compare all specifications:

2009 Land Rover Defender 2010 Porsche 911
Make Land Rover Porsche
Model Defender 911
Year Released 2009 2010
Body Type SUV Convertible
Engine Position Front Rear
Engine Size 2402 cc 3600 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 6 cylinders
Engine Type in-line boxer
Valves per Cylinder 4 valves 4 valves
Horse Power 120 HP 345 HP
Engine RPM 3500 RPM 6500 RPM
Torque 360 Nm 390 Nm
Torque RPM 2000 RPM 4400 RPM
Fuel Type Diesel Gasoline
Drive Type 4WD AWD
Transmission Type Manual Manual
Number of Seats 4 seats 4 seats
Number of Doors 3 doors 2 doors
Vehicle Weight 2708 kg 1555 kg
Vehicle Length 3900 mm 4465 mm
Vehicle Width 1970 mm 1808 mm
Vehicle Height 1930 mm 1311 mm
Wheelbase Size 2370 mm 2350 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 60 L 67 L
